Egil Ulfstein (born 1 October 1971) is a retired Norwegian football defender.
A son of IL Hødd legend Jan Ulfstein, Egil Ulfstein played for Hødd himself and represented Norway on u-21 level.{{cite news|title=Brann vil ha U-landslagsspiller|date=5 October 1992|author=Jansen Hagen, Vegard|work=Bergens Tidende|page=21|language=Norwegian}} Ahead of the 1993 season he was bought by Viking, moving to Brann in 1998. He was also capped twice for Norway in a 1995 tour of the Caribbean.{{NFF|2885501}} In the 2004 season he only featured in a single match, a cup thrashing of Hødd. Brann and Ulfstein went on to become cup champions, but Ulfstein retired after the season.{{cite news|title=Sport: notiser|date=8 November 2004|work=Bergens Tidende|page=18|language=Norwegian}}
